One of the best ways to keep your energy costs down when you live in an apartment is by focusing on electricity savings. Reducing your utility bill benefits you, your landlord, and the environment. 1. Use LED Light Bulbs

If you haven’t already swapped out the light bulbs in your apartment for LED bulbs, you’re missing out. LED bulbs use less energy and last longer, making them cost-effective. A simple switch can add up to significant savings in the long run.

2. Unplug Appliances When Not in Use

Leaving appliances on standby mode can consume up to 20% of the energy that they would if they were turned on. You can save a lot on your electric bill by unplugging appliances when not in use, especially ones that have lights or displays. Try connecting groups of appliances to power strips, and turn them off when they’re not in use.

3. Use a Smart Thermostat

A smart thermostat is an excellent investment for those who want to maximize their energy savings. You can program the thermostat to adjust the temperature when you’re not in the apartment, resulting in less energy use. They can also learn your daily behaviors and adjust temperature settings accordingly, optimizing overall energy consumption.

4. Take Advantage of Natural Light

Whenever possible, use natural light by opening window coverings during the day. Instead of relying on artificial lighting throughout the day, you can use the sun’s rays to light up your apartment. This could reduce energy consumption and our daily bills.

5. Use Energy Star Appliances

If you’re in the market for a new appliance, consider purchasing an Energy Star-rated appliance. They consume far less energy than their non-certified counterparts and are more environmentally friendly. Additionally, Washington State is offering rebates for Energy Star products.
